Application of Set Screw
 

Mechanical Assemblies

Set screws are essential for securing pulleys, gears, and couplings to shafts. They prevent components from rotating or slipping, ensuring efficient power transmission and smooth operation of machinery.

Electronics and Instrumentation

In electronics and instrumentation, set screws often feature nylon tips or flat points to secure delicate components without causing damage or vibrations. This is particularly important in sensitive equipment where precision and stability are essential.

Furniture and Cabinetry

In the furniture and cabinetry industry, set screws are used to firmly secure knobs, handles, and other decorative elements, maintaining the aesthetic integrity of the furniture while ensuring these elements remain securely attached.

Automotive and Aerospace

In these high-stakes environments, the precision and reliability of set screws are crucial. They are used to secure engine components and aircraft instrumentation, providing stability and safety.

HVAC and Plumbing

Set screws secure key components, ensuring efficient and reliable operation in HVAC systems and plumbing fixtures. They hold fan blades in place within HVAC systems and secure faucets in plumbing applications.

Machinery and Tooling

Set screws are often used in jigs and fixtures to maintain precise positioning and stability of workpieces during machining and assembly processes.

 

Types of Set Screw
 

Cup Point Set Screw: Features a concave tip for increased grip, making it ideal for fixtures where material penetration is acceptable. Commonly used in machine parts and for securing pulleys or levers.

 

Knurled Cup Point Set Screw: Similar to the cup point but with knurled edges for enhanced grip, providing strong friction. Utilized in high-vibration environments where extra holding power is needed.

 

Cone Point Set Screw: Tapered point designed to embed into surfaces, suitable for fixtures in softer materials that require a secure fit. Ideal for assemblies needing frequent adjustments, like collars or stops.

 

Oval Point Set Screw: Features a rounded tip for smooth contact, used where minimal surface damage is desired. Typically applied in precision equipment adjustments where repeated loosening is expected.

Dog & Half Dog Point Set Screw: Extends beyond the end with a flat point, engaging into slots for precise alignment. Used in machining applications where exact positioning is critical, such as shaft positioning.

 

Flat Point Set Screw: Flat-ended and fully threaded, it provides lateral force without deep penetration and is easy to adjust or remove. Often used in electronics or applications where marking is unacceptable.

 

Soft-Tipped Point Set Screw: Has a soft material tip like nylon to prevent damage to softer surfaces while maintaining secure hold. Common in electronics and delicate assemblies like securing plastics or soft metals.

 

Ball-Point Set Screws: Includes a rounded metal ball end, allowing for slight movement or tilt of the secured object for precision alignments. Utilized in flexible or pivoting connections, such as alignment devices or camera mounts.

Q: How does a set screw work?

A: Set screws work by exerting compressive force through their tip to prevent relative movement between two components, rather than holding them together with threads like traditional screws. They are typically used to secure one object inside another, with the screw's tip pressing against the inner object.

Q: Do set screws need a flat?

A: Set screws are not always the best way to resist the torque of driven shafts. To reduce the chance of slipping and to increase load capacity, a detent (often called a "flat") may be milled or ground at the part of the shaft where the set screw's point contacts.

Q: What is the difference between a grub screw and a set screw?

A: Grub screws and set screws are essentially the same type of fastener, often used interchangeably, though some might distinguish them based on the type of drive used or how they're used. Both are typically fully threaded, headless screws that can be recessed into a surface, often used to secure components to shafts or other objects.
